M.R. Hall is the writing name of Matthew Hall, a British screenwriter and novelist born in 1967. Jenny Cooper, a coroner working in England, is the central figure of Hall's crime fiction, and the series opens with The Coroner (2009). Ten titles are catalogued through 2020, reaching The Black Art of Killing, and they take in suicide, criminal investigation and the work of the coroner's court. Writing Crime Fiction (2015) is Hall's short guide to the form.
